How to Fix a Broken Sewer Line
Issues with the drain line have actually been extremely bothering for house owners. Paired with the unpleasant scent and stress and anxiety of clearing the mess from leaking sewer pipes, the expense of fixing is also in the high side. While blocking may be easily detected, there are a few other troubles like leakage that are harder to spot as well as expensive to be fixed. Drain line pipelines can endure deterioration and also logging which leads them to burst open. Allow's consider a few of the sources of drain line damage.

Blocked pipelines


The sewage system can not manage web content that will certainly not conveniently degrade. Flushing points Iike nylon and also paper towels down the drain gradually can cause your sewer line being clogged. Oil and grease can likewise obstruct your sewer line which is why they must be thrown out in a container rather than down the tubes.

Fractured Pipes


Pressure from the surroundings can cause sewer line pipes to split. Tree origins can twist around sewage system lines and also compromise and even split the pipelines bring about leak. Sewage system lines in older homes are much more susceptible to this type of damages.

Corroded Piping


Calcium and also magnesium accumulate with time can make sewage pipes rust. The rust if left ignored to can trigger fractures as well as leakages in the future.

If Your Sewer Line Demands Fixing, exactly how to Know


It is important to enjoy out for signs that point to harm in your sewer line so that they can be attended to on time. A blockage anywhere aims to clogging of the sewage system lines. The look of mould or cracks on the wall surface also aims to some level of water drainage or sewer line trouble as well as this have to be attended to quickly.

Drain Line Fixing or Replacement


Relying on the degree of damages your sewer line may require repair services or substitute of some parts that are not breaking down to par. A drain line evaluation ought to be performed with a drain electronic camera to figure out the level of the damage. For minor damages, pipeline lining is an exceptional repair choice; non-time as well as cost-efficient consuming. Trenchless sewer line repair work is also an option. For more major problems, the standard approach of excavating and also excavation may be needed to alter the whole drain line. This is an intrusive technique that is both lengthy as well as pricey. To stop sewer line damage from dragging as well as taking place in enough time prior to being identified, have sewer line examinations performed every year and ensure that only materials that will break down are purged down the tubes. Appropriate use your sewage system will prolong its life-span. Eliminate trees that are triggering damage or most likely to trigger damages to your sewage system line from the facilities.

Sewer Line Repair and Replacement


Generally speaking, all types of pipes are vulnerable to breakage due to extreme pressure, be it inner (water) or outer (ground). However, one of the worst pipe malfunctions one can experience is that of a damaged sewer pipe. Cracked sewer pipes are not only costly to repair but they can present serious health hazards. When a sewer line fails, a repair is the first line of defense. When repair is not a viable option, we turn to sewer line replacement.


Common Causes of Sewer Line Damage


  • Poor maintenance

  • Regular ground freezes/thaws

  • Wear and tear due to aging

  • Backup from a city’s sewer line

  • Infiltration of tree roots on sewer pipe holes and joints

  • Poor sewer pipe layout, design and/or installation

  • A buildup of debris, grease, hair, oil, sludge, toilet paper, other materials

  • Earth movement, such as earthquakes or nearby heavy construction, etc.

  • Signs of a Broken Sewer Pipe


  • Gurgling sounds coming from your toilet

  • Receded water in your toilet

  • Sewage backup in your toilet and/or tub

  • Slow draining bathtub or failure to drain

  • Noticeably greener grass near your sewage pipe

  • Your yard is flooded with water

  • Sewer odor in your yard, basement, or another area

    Typically a complete sewer line replacement will last for well over 50 years, be guaranteed unconditionally for 10 years, and require no maintenance whatsoever. The advantages of a complete sewer line replacement include:


  • There is no expense to diagnose the point of the problem and location of where the house sewer runs, which can sometimes exceed $1,000.

  • Back-pitched sewer pipe can be corrected with a replacement – a repair can typically not accomplish that.

  • There is little chance of excavating in the wrong area, which can waste thousands of dollars.

  • There is confidence in knowing that the sewer problem is solved once-and-for-all.
